It is with honor that I  announce that nominations are open for this years 
recipient of the NLRS Wesslund  Award.  Nominations must be made in written form 
(email, snail mail, direct  copy, etc) and given to one of your NLRS club 
officers (W0ZQ, N0UK, or  KC0IYT).  The award will be presented at Aurora'08 
during the afternoon  business meeting.  Current club officers are excluded.  The 
award  committee, comprised of the three club officers, W0AUS, and membership  
representation, shall review all written nominations and make the final  
selection.

The Wesslund Award states: "The Wesslund Award honors Robert  (Bob) Wesslund, 
W0AUS, for his many years of significant contributions to the  Northern 
Lights Radio Society and for his continuous work with mentoring others  in the 
World above 50 MHz.  This award is presented annually to recognize  those NLRS 
members who have assisted others in gaining knowledge and access to  the bands 
above 50 MHz."

Written nominations should be short but should  exemplify those attributes 
outlined above.   Past winners are Bob  Wesslund, W0AUS (2004), Donn Baker, 
WA2VOI (2005), Jon Lieberg, K0FQA (2006),  and Gary Mohrlant, W0GHZ (2007).
